About the East End market
What is the median home price in East End, ID?
The median sale price in East End, ID is $606,444 (data through July 2026), based on deeds recorded with the county.
How many homes sell in East End, ID each year?
18 homes sold in East End, ID over the last 12 months (data through July 2026). TopHap counts recorded arm's-length deeds, not listings, so the figure is not affected by which brokerage handled the sale.
How many homes are there in East End, ID?
East End, ID contains 2,624 residential properties, with a median of 2,102 square feet, 3 bedrooms, built around 1979. The median TopHap Estimate is $739K.
How does East End, ID compare to the rest of Ada County?
By median home value, East End, ID is the 12th most expensive of 46 neighborhoods in Ada County. Its typical home is worth more than 78% of all homes in Ada County. North End ranks just above it and Century Farm just below. The ranking is rebuilt nightly from the county assessor record of every home in each area.
Do people own or rent in East End, ID?
77% of homes in East End, ID are owner-occupied. 29% are held by a company rather than an individual.
How much equity do owners in East End, ID hold?
65% of mortgaged homes in East End, ID are equity-rich, meaning the loan balance is under half the home's value. 2.0% owe more than the home is worth.
